Thermo-optical control of L-band lasing in Er-doped tellurite glass microsphere with blue laser diode

Abstract

Miniature lasers based on rare-earth ion-doped tellurite microsphere resonators with whispering gallery modes (WGMs) are promising devices for basic research and applications. However, the excitation of WGMs using an external pump is not a simple task requiring passive or active control. We propose and demonstrate the implementation of thermo-optical control of the L-band laser generation in an Er-doped in-band pumped tellurite glass microsphere using a cheap low-power blue laser diode and a constant-wavelength telecom laser as a pump. The proposed scheme ensures simplification and cost reduction of microlasers.
